M-1 Challenge 72: Kunchenko vs. Abdulaev - November 18 (OFFICIAL DISCUSSION)
Sat Oct 15, 2016 3:04 pm
M-1 Challenge 72
November 18, 2016
Crocus City Hall
Moscow, Russia
Main Card:
Alexey Kunchenko (14-0) vs. (15-4) Murad Abdulaev
Main Event | Title Fight | Welterweight | 170 lbs (77 Kg)
Alexey Makhno (13-4) vs. (21-10) Artiom Damkovsky
Co-Main Event | Lightweight | 155 lbs (70 Kg)
Artem Frolov (7-0) vs. (26-14) Luigi Fioravanti
Main Card | Middleweight | 185 lbs (84 Kg)
The rematch between former M-1 Champion Murad Abdulaev and reigning one Alexey Kunchenko is set for M-1 Challenge 72, November 18th, Moscow.
Alexey Kunchenko (14-0) is an undedeated MMA Welterweight fighter from Russia and reigning M-1 Global Champion, representing team New Stream and Boets fight club. He is a powerful striker who has 80% of his win held via KO/TKO. He defeated Murad Abdulev via TKO in the 4th round of their 1st fight.
Murad Abdulaev (15-4) is a former M-1 Champion from Fighting Eagle team, Dagestan. He is a well-rounded fighter with a great endurance. He took his time to recover from the recent defeat and now is ready for a comeback.

Artiom Damkovsky vs Alexey Makhno fight is set for M-1 Challenge 72, November 18.
Artiom Damkovsky (21-10) is a former M-1 Global Lightweight Champion whose signature features are impressive striking and great fighting will. He tends to exchange powerful shots in stand-up and doesn't afraid of taking damage in return. In his latest M-1 appearance, Artiom Damkovsky defeated another former M-1 Champion - Max Divnich (12-2) and amended his previous loss to Alexander Butenko. Damkovsky's total MMA record is 5-1 starting from 2014 up to the present date.
Alexey Makhno (13-4) is a local MMA star and young prospect of M-1 lightweight division. He is a basic kickboxer with a solid striking skills. In his recent fight Alexey Makhno defeated Felipe Rego (7-3) from Brasil. His only loss for the last 2 years was inflicted by Rauli Tutarauli one year ago.

Artem Frolov vs Luigi Fioravanti fight is set for M-1 Challenge 72
Artem Frolov (7-0) is an undefeated middleweight fighter from Krasnodar city, Russia. He represents Kuznya Fight Club and Team Legion. Being a solid striker, Artem Frolov is a formidable grappler, as he is a Combat Sambo master os sports. He's leading 7 fights winning streak with 60% of wins taken via submission. According to M-1 Global matchmakers, the win over Luigi Fioravanti makes Artem the next middleweight title contender.
Luigi Fioravanti (26-14) is an experienced MMA veteran from St. Louis, Missouri, USA. He hasn't fought for 1 year since his recent loss to Ramazan Emeev in M-1 title fight. Luigi Fioravanti is a well-rounded fighter with no obvious lacks. He can strike and possess a meaningful KO power, and he is also good in parter. The win over surging Russian prospect will allow Luigi to came back in title run.

Damir Ismagulov vs Rubenilton Pereira fight added to M-1 Challenge 72
Damir Ismagulov (6-2) is a promising lightweight fighter from Russia. He represents "New Stream" Team and "Boets" Fight Club. Damir is a well-rounded fighter with great striking skills. He moves quick around the opponent and posesses a deadly danger at far distance of the fight. Ismagulov leads 3 fights winning streak with only 2 career defeats. Damir should have become the Lighweight title contender and face Alexander Butenko at M-1 Challenge 71, but unfortunate injury crossed over those plans. Now Damir is ready for a comeback where he faces a sudden prospect from Brasil in person of Rubenilton Pereira.
Rubenilton Pereira (16-3) is a 23 years old lightweight prospect from Brasil. He is a well-rounded fighter with a solid fighting spirit. In his non-title fight with Alexander Butenko, Rubenilton showed extraordinary perseverance and almost finished Butenko during the fight. However, suffering a decision loss in the end, Rubenilton Pereira impressed M-1 Global management so much that he got another chance to prove his TOP-level of fighting. Now Pereira will face the fighter who was planned to become the next title contender!
